Output 29dde707b05c6c115e61ee1d623bf5b292f6766df2e93c9066ee1fae46e5d0bc:0

value
2321892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a02d3efd30714d707623f13b00dee19088821f OP_EQUAL
address
357xov7rzwDqgMx6y5yh4obUArggkwQx1f
transaction
29dde707b05c6c115e61ee1d623bf5b292f6766df2e93c9066ee1fae46e5d0bc
spent
true